Thanks for posting Ales. This may help someone ID the issue with the difference in the shaders.

The NVIDIA GeForce 320M is an integrated chipset graphics card w/o dedicated graphics memory. Maybe the improved shaders 3.0 upgrade need more memory?

Link to comment
Share on other sites

Ales, if you don't mind getting in touch with me, I can send you some shaders that may work better for your card. My email is my first name, as above, at battlefront.com.

Buzz is right, the upgraded shaders are more resource-intensive, and your card is old enough that it a) can't be lumped in with more modern Nvidia cards but B) due to the way OpenGL works on OSX, CM may not be able to discover that information automatically.

Yep, we're planning on doing a hotfix for CMSF; Apple changed something in their drivers that causes CM to crash pretty horribly on larger maps. We created a workaround and we'll push it out for CMSF at some point in the near future.

We'll wait til we're done and then update. (Is that necessary or can it be done mid PBEM game? )

Upgrading game is not fully guaranteed and if it does not work you have to go back to the older version to play. Having said that it is very doable. So far every patch and upgrade that has come out I have updated a PBEM that was on going and it has never failed. There have been a few times that the first minute of play back after the update included a god awful air plane engine sound - bleck. Thank fully that only happens once in a while and it only lasts for that first minute.

There are two important things to remember if you update a PBEM game:

1) coordinate with your opponent - no body likes surprises like "hey I copy the turn but it does not show up in the saved game list"

2) the procedure for update is: watch the replay, press the BRB, save the game, install the update, open the saved game, issue orders, press the BRB and pass the turn file on to your opponent.

3) coordinate with your opponent - no body likes surprises...
